This content summarizes a video documenting the process of finding a suitable planer for a small woodworking shop. Due to space constraints, the creator chose the DeWalt 735X model from various small planers. This model received high ratings in online reviews but was criticized for its high noise level.

To address the planer's noise problem, the creator attempted a helical head (spiral blade) modification using the Shelix system. Helical head planers offer several advantages over straight-knife planers. The numerous small blades arranged in a spiral pattern result in smoother cutting, less noise, and improved durability because even if one blade is damaged, the others can continue working. However, helical head planers are typically used in large industrial models, and smaller models are generally considered to have inferior performance.

The content details the process of installing the Shelix helical head on the DeWalt 735X planer. The modification process involved complex disassembly of the planer and required the creator to forfeit the manufacturer's warranty. After modification, noise level measurements using a sound level meter showed a noise reduction of approximately 5-10 dBA compared to the straight-knife blade. Cutting performance also improved, resulting in a smoother surface finish. However, the drawbacks of increased power consumption and a higher probability of the planer stopping during operation were also noted.

The following table compares the characteristics of the planer before and after modification:

FeatureBefore Modification (Straight Knife)After Modification (Helical Head)
Noise Level (dBA)100~10790~100
Cutting PerformanceAverageExcellent
DurabilityLowHigh
Power ConsumptionLowHigh
Price$689.99 (Planer) + $158 (Stand)$689.99 (Planer) + $158 (Stand) + $400 (Shelix)
